4. Conclusions
- (1)
- The temperature and velocity on the air-inlet side of the serpentine heat exchanger are lower compared to other regions, forming a heat transfer dead zone. The primary reason for this phenomenon is that the air-inlet side is located at the end of the serpentine tube, where the high-temperature flue gas entering the tube continuously dissipates heat along its path until it reaches the end where the air enters. By that point, the temperature has significantly decreased, resulting in limited heat transfer in this area and creating a heat transfer dead zone. Increasing the distance between the serpentine protrusions expands the heat transfer area, making heat transfer more uniform, while also enlarging the Nusselt number (Nu) and enhancing convective heat transfer efficiency. With a serpentine protrusion spacing of h = 330 mm, under the same flow rate, Nu increased by a maximum of 23.39%.
- (2)
- The air inlet-velocity within the shell significantly influences the performance of the heat exchanger. Increasing the velocity can raise Re, thereby strengthening convective heat transfer and improving Nu. However, excessively high inlet velocities can enlarge the negative pressure area before the shell outlet, leading to increased pressure and uneven heat transfer in localized areas. When exploring the optimal air-inlet velocity, one can start experimenting from low velocities and gradually increase the inlet flow rate, continuing until the heat transfer efficiency reaches a maximum and stabilizes, achieving the optimal inlet air velocity condition.
- (3)
- The diameter of the serpentine tubes shows an inverse relationship with Nu. Enlarging the tube diameter increases the heat exchange area but reduces the heat transfer rate per unit area. This reduction leads to a decrease in the convective heat transfer coefficient, subsequently decreasing Nu. Through comprehensive analysis, when d = 80 mm and h = 300 mm, the highest percentage increase in Nu concerning Re is 25.17%. At this point, the convective heat transfer strength is at its peak, resulting in optimal heat transfer performance.
